Description

An exceptional opportunity to acquire an ideal family residence in the sought-after Berengrave Gardens development. This four-bedroom gem is strategically situated near Ofsted rated 'Good' primary, secondary, and Grammar schools, ensuring a top-notch education for your family.

Boasting a convenient location just under a mile from Rainham train station, this property provides seamless access to London through excellent train connections, including high-speed options. For those who commute by car, the location offers also offers convenient access to major motorways.

Enjoy the surrounding countryside with leisurely walks through expansive open spaces, a nearby nature reserve, charming local orchards, and Rainham Cricket Club.

Upon entering, the welcoming entrance hall leads you to a spacious bay-fronted lounge, an ideal space for relaxation. The kitchen/diner is perfect for entertaining, complemented by a utility room, downstairs cloakroom, and a dedicated study, ideal for those working from home.

Upstairs, the first-floor landing unveils four generously sized bedrooms, including an en-suite shower room for the master, and a well-appointed family bathroom.

Enhancing the appeal of this property are practical features such as a rear garden with gated access to the front, a single garage, and a driveway with space for two vehicles. Convenience is key, making day-to-day life effortlessly smooth.

Within walking distance, discover Rainham railway station, the town centre, and a diverse range of amenities, ensuring that all your daily needs are met with ease.
